Referrals & partners
Anyone can refer a friend - no application, no minimum plan. Businesses and individuals who want to refer customers at scale can apply for a paid partner tier instead.
Your referral link
Settings > Plan & Billing has a "Refer a friend" card with your personal link. Share it however you like - social, email, a blog post. Clicking it starts a 30-day window: if the person signs up and then upgrades to a paid plan within that window, the referral counts.
- They get 20% off their first month.
- You get a month of Plus in credit.
Credits show up as a running balance on the same card. They're informational for now - reach out to support if you'd like an existing balance applied to an upcoming invoice by hand.
The partner program
Affiliate and Agency are paid tiers for anyone referring customers regularly - a content creator, a consultancy, an agency reselling access. Applying needs a Plus plan or above; apply from the same "Refer a friend" card.
| Tier | Commission | How long |
|---|---|---|
| Affiliate | 20% of every payment | First 12 months of each referral |
| Agency | 30% of every payment | Ongoing, no cap |
Applications are reviewed by hand, not auto-approved. Once approved, your commission is calculated automatically every time a customer you referred pays, and a monthly statement is available on request.
Keeping it fair
A referral is only credited or commissioned once it passes a few basic checks:
- You can't refer yourself.
- The same payment card can't be used to fake a referral between two accounts.
- An unusual burst of sign-ups through one link is flagged for a manual look before anything pays out.
A flagged referral still appears in your stats so nothing silently disappears - it's simply held back from credit until reviewed.
